Building the Field of Social Work

We’re building the field of social work by providing interns with the experience they need to become compassionate, trauma-informed advocates.

Each year, JPA offers advanced-level clinical internships to a select group of graduate students in the mental health field. Our highly competitive program includes hands-on experience providing individual and small group therapy for school-aged children.

Here’s what our interns are saying...

What I found most valuable about the internship program is the emphasis on reflective supervision and the amount of it that we got. It was extremely helpful to get different perspectives on some of our cases, such as through group supervision, weekly case presentations, and individual supervision. It forced me to really reflect on the work that I was doing inside the therapy room, but also reflect on the balance between schoolwork and internship.

– Eric V., JPA Clinical Intern
